Background: Vulvar and vaginal dryness accompanied by discomfort is a common problem among women. This problem occurs at various stages of life, including premenopausal, postpartum and postoperative periods. Although hormone therapy is the conventional approach, there is a need for effective and safe non-hormonal alternatives.

Objective: To evaluate the vaginal microbiome, as well as efficacy and safety of Xylalgin vaginal suppositories in women with symptoms of vaginal dryness and related discomfort.

Materials and methods: This was an observational study including 80 female patients who applied Xylalgin once daily in the vagina for 7–10 days. Microbiome was assessed by fluorescence in situ hybridization (FISH).

Results: The suppositories demonstrated a statistically significant reduction in vulvar and vaginal itching and dryness, and an increase in the Vaginal Health Index. The FISH data showed a tendency to normalization of the vaginal microbiome, which was expressed in a decrease in the number of opportunistic microorganisms and an increase in the proportion of lactobacilli that are characteristic of normocenosis. No adverse events associated with the use of suppositories were observed. The effect of the suppositories was rated as completely satisfactory by 84% of the patients.

Conclusion: Xylalgin is a promising non-hormonal treatment for relieving symptoms of vulvar and vaginal dryness and discomfort, helping to improve women’s quality of life. The study emphasizes the importance of finding safe and effective solutions for this common problem.
